web2py 也显示 id

web2py displays id too

我在 default.py 中得到了这个代码:

form_0 = SQLFORM(db.base_folder, record=db.base_folder(1))
query = db.base_folder.folder != ''
set = db(query)
rows = set.select()
if rows:
    form_0.vars.folder = rows[0]['folder']

并在 db.py 中:

db.define_table(
'base_folder',
Field('folder',
      type='string',
      default='You need to set up a directory to backup to !',
    ),
    format='%(folder)s'
)

不幸的是,显示的表格还显示:

id: 1

在字段值之上。当我省略记录选项时,这个问题就消失了。

请问我该如何避免这种行为 - 因为我需要保持更新 函数 ?

谢谢,

SQLFORM(db.base_folder, record=db.base_folder(1), showid=False)